As a Supply Chain Planner at Cognyte, you will be responsible for ensuring the efficient flow of material throughout our supply chain. This includes demand, supply & production planning, inventory management, and coordinating with suppliers to optimize costs and meet customer demands. You will play a critical role in maintaining our supply chain's reliability and responsiveness.

Demand Forecasting and Planning:

  • Develop and maintain demand forecasts for product and material, taking into account business objectives and sales strategies.
  • Develop, track and update demand scenarios and customer orders material simulation to prepare for various market conditions.

Inventory Management:

  • Monitor and manage inventory levels to ensure the right balance between supply and demand. Aim to minimize stockouts while reducing excess inventory.
  • Establish & implement Inventory Management processes to limit excess and obsolete inventory while ensuring optimal material availability, order fulfillment & Procurement spend.

Material Supply Management:

  • Develop and maintain a Material Requirements Plan (MRP) to ensure that all necessary materials are available for production when needed.
  • Plan, schedule, and monitor the movement of material through the production cycle. Plan and execute inventory replenishment strategies to maintain optimal stock levels and minimize obsolescence.

Production Planning:

  • Collaborate with the production team to develop and maintain the master production schedule, ensuring it aligns with demand forecasts and inventory targets.
  • Production Planning and Scheduling, Capacity Planning for production & contract manufacturing resources.

Data Analysis, Reporting & Presentation:

  • Present data in a clear, compelling, and actionable manner using graphs, charts, and other visualization tools. Maintain data dashboards and visualizations that support data-driven decision-making.
  • Regularly prepare and present reports on key performance indicators (KPIs) related to supply chain efficiency.

Collaboration:

  • Develop and maintain strong supplier relationships ensuring aligned material supply plans.
  • Work closely and communicate with other departments, including procurement, finance, logistics, operations and engineering, to ensure alignment and transparency across the supply chain.
